Over the weekend, experimenters found that OpenAI’s new chatbot, ChatGPT, can hallucinate simulations of Linux shells and picture dialing into a bulletin board system (BBS). The chatbot, primarily based on a deep studying AI mannequin, makes use of its saved data to simulate Linux with stunning outcomes, together with executing Python code and looking digital web sites.
Final week, OpenAI made ChatGPT freely available throughout a testing part, which has led to folks probing its capabilities and weaknesses in novel methods.
On Saturday, a DeepMind analysis scientist named Jonas Degrave labored out how one can instruct ChatGPT to behave like a Linux shell by getting into this immediate:
I need you to behave as a Linux terminal. I’ll sort instructions and you’ll reply with what the terminal ought to present. I need you to solely reply with the terminal output inside one distinctive code block, and nothing else. Don’t write explanations. Don’t sort instructions until I instruct you to take action. Once I must let you know one thing in English I’ll achieve this by placing textual content inside curly brackets {like this}. My first command is pwd.
On Monday, Ars discovered that the trick nonetheless works. After getting into this immediate, as a substitute of chatting, OpenGPT will settle for simulated Linux instructions. It then returns responses in “code block” formatting. For instance, if you happen to sort ls -al, you will see an instance listing construction.

ChatGPT can simulate a Linux machine as a result of sufficient details about how a Linux machine ought to behave was included in its coaching knowledge. That knowledge probably consists of software program documentation (like manual pages), troubleshooting posts on Web boards, and logged output from shell periods.
ChatGPT generates responses primarily based on which phrase is statistically most certainly to observe the final collection of phrases, beginning with the immediate enter by the consumer. It continues the dialog (on this case, a simulated Linux console session) by together with your whole dialog historical past in successive prompts.
Degrave discovered that the simulation goes surprisingly deep. Utilizing its data of the Python programming language (that powers GitHub Copilot), ChatGPT’s digital Linux machine can execute code too, comparable to this string created by Degrave for example: echo -e “x = lambda y: y*5+3;print(‘Consequence: ‘ + str(x(6)))” > run.py && python3 run.py. In accordance with Degrave, it returns the proper worth of “33”.

Throughout our testing, we discovered you may create directories, change between them, set up simulated packages with apt-get, and even Telnet right into a simulated MUSH and construct a room or hook up with a MUD and struggle a troll.
Each time deficiencies emerge within the simulation, you may inform ChatGPT the way you need it to behave utilizing directions in curly braces, as spelled out within the authentic immediate. For instance, whereas “linked” to our simulated MUD, we broke character and requested ChatGPT to summon a troll assault. Fight proceeded as anticipated (protecting observe of hit factors correctly) till the troll died by the hands of our twice-virtual sword.

In Degrave’s examples (which he wrote about in detail on his weblog), he additionally constructed a Docker file, checked for a GPU, pinged a simulated area identify, browsed a simulated web site with lynx, and extra. The simulated rabbit gap goes deep, and ChatGPT may even hallucinate new Linux commands.
Dialing a hallucinated BBS
In a prompting maneuver just like conjuring up an AI-hallucinated Linux shell, somebody named gfodor on Twitter discovered that OpenGPT may simulate calling a vintage dial-up BBS, together with initializing a modem, getting into a chat room, and speaking to a simulated particular person.

So long as the immediate doesn’t set off its built-in filters associated to violence, hate, or sexual content material (amongst different issues), ChatGPT appears keen to go together with nearly any imaginary journey. Folks have additionally found it might play tic-tac-toe, faux to be an ATM, or simulate a chat room.
In a means, ChatGPT is performing like a text-based Holodeck, the place its AI will try to simulate no matter you need it to do.
We must always word that whereas hallucinating copiously is ChatGPT’s robust swimsuit (by design), returning factual data reliably stays a work in progress. Nonetheless, with AI like ChatGPT round, the way forward for inventive gaming could also be very enjoyable.
